Challenges: The project is an initiative of the Nahda Youth Organization, as there is no major donor and funder for the project, and Enmaa relies on in-kind and cash donations. This has caused us a large deficit in terms of providing meals and continuing distribution, as it depends on the generosity of donors and their giving. Among the challenges are that there are other needs such as school uniforms, school bags, and awareness raising. Family needs and also family needs so that the family is able to care for the student and encourage him to continue education, such as the poverty of families and their dependence on child labor. The project to feed 320 male and female students for marginalized students is a project that was launched by the Al Nahda Youth Organization in 2022, and is still ongoing. It aims to provide healthy and balanced meals for marginalized students, both male and female, in three areas in Taiz Governorate - Yemen. The most vulnerable areas are the areas of the marginalized, as they They suffer from poverty, hunger, marginalization and discrimination in education. The project targets 320 male and female students on a daily basis from various primary classrooms, and continues for a full academic year.
The project was not limited to distributing meals only, but also included distributing psychological support bags and school uniforms to marginalized girls. It also included organizing awareness and educational workshops for parents, teachers, and students about the importance of proper nutrition, mental health, and dealing with bullying and school violence. The project also participated in solving some of the problems facing the targeted students, such as providing school supplies, school uniforms, and transportation to schools.
Recently, at the beginning of the new academic year, the project achieved amazing results in improving the situation of marginalized male and female students. The attendance rate increased to 72%, the dropout rate decreased to 25%, educational results improved by 55%, and the level of self-confidence and belonging to school increased by 53%. . These are some ratios that show and illustrate the results of the project's continued progress
